Art and Activism in Chicago
This chapter examines the role of place-based art in Chicago, highlighting a project that uses remnants from a demolished jail to reflect on the city's violent history and themes of freedom. It also focuses on the Folded Map Project, which aims to bridge socio-economic divides through artistic expression and community dialogue, showcasing the stark discrepancies between neighborhoods. The chapter emphasizes the importance of personal stories in fostering understanding and promoting social justice across Chicago's diverse communities.
